Rain affects domestic flights at TIA



KATHMANDU: Rain on Friday partially affected domestic flights at Tribhuvan International Airport (TIA).

International flights, however, have not been affected, according to General Manager Debendra KC at the TIA, adding that low visibility has affected flights since today morning.

According to him, domestic flights to mountainous and hilly areas have been affected.
